difference between to me/you and for me/you

which is correct and if both are right what is the difference between them?

- is it heavy for you? / is it heavy to you?
- it is heavy for youEmotion: it wasnt me/ it is heavy to youEmotion: it wasnt me

is it too heavy for me/you? and it is too heavy for me/you - definately seems like a better choice than ' too heavy to me/you'
  

Top answer

Is it too heavy for you to carry? Does it seem heavy to you?

  • Is it too heavy for you to carry?
  • Does it seem heavy to you?
